Umee Technologies Inc. and Basic Inc. will co-host a free online seminar, 'Leveraging 'First-hand Information' from Sales Meetings for Strategy Formulation,' on June 11, 2026. This seminar will provide practical know-how on analyzing B2B sales conversation data with AI to extract customer insights and elevate them into marketing strategies. It is targeted at marketing managers and executives who want to transform valuable, often siloed, information from the sales floor into a company-wide asset and build a competitive advantage in the AI era.

- Q: What are the benefits of analyzing sales meetings with AI?
- A: The main benefit is the ability to objectively analyze all sales meetings as data, without relying on the memory or intuition of individual representatives. This allows for identifying success/failure factors, accurately grasping customer needs, and improving the precision of marketing initiatives.
